Types of Chromosomal and DNA Tests Available
The types of chromosomal and DNA tests available in Romania can be categorized into several groups, including:
- Health Risk Testing - These tests assess an individual’s risk of developing certain genetic disorders and conditions.
- Ancestry Testing - This category helps individuals trace their lineage and understand their ethnic backgrounds.
- Carrier Screening - Aimed at prospective parents, these tests determine if one is a carrier of genetic conditions that could be passed to children.
- Prenatal Testing - Tests designed to detect potential genetic disorders in a fetus.
